Tensorflow.JS - TF.POW

Tensorflow.JS - TF.POW
„TF.pow () im Tensorflow.JS wird verwendet, um die Leistung in Bezug auf die Werte in einem anderen Tensor zu erhöhen.”

Szenario 1: Arbeiten Sie mit Skalar

Skalar speichert nur einen Wert. Trotzdem gibt es einen Tensor zurück.

Syntax

tf.pow (scalar1, scalar2)

Parameter
Scalar1 und Scalar2 sind die Tensoren, die nur einen Wert als Parameter einnehmen können.

Zurückkehren
Rückstand von zwei Skalarwerten.

Beispiel
Erstellen Sie zwei Skalare und erhöhen.






Tensorflow.JS - TF.pow ()




Ausgang

Arbeiten
3 zur Leistung von 4 => 3*3*3*3 = 81.

Szenario 2: Arbeiten Sie mit Tensor

Ein Tensor kann mehrere Werte speichern; Es kann einzeln oder mehrdimensional sein.

Syntax

tf.POW (Tensor1, Tensor2)

Parameter
Tensor1 und Tensor2 sind die Tensoren, die nur einzelne oder mehrere Werte als Parameter einnehmen können.

Zurückkehren
Wertekraft.

Wir müssen feststellen, dass die Gesamtzahl der Elemente in beiden Tensoren gleich sein muss.

Beispiel 1
Erstellen Sie zwei eindimensionale Tensor.






Tensorflow.JS - TF.pow ()




Ausgang

Arbeiten
[2 Power 1,3 Power 2,4 Power 3,] => Tensor [2,9,64].

Beispiel 2
Erstellen Sie 2 zweidimensionale Tensoren mit 2 Zeilen und 3 Spalten und wenden Sie TF an.pow ().






Tensorflow.JS - TF.pow ()




Ausgang

Szenario 3: Arbeiten mit Tensor & Scalar

Es kann möglich sein, die Leistung jedes Elements in einem Tensor durch einen Skalar zu erhöhen.

Syntax

tf.POW (Tensor, Skalar)

Beispiel
Erstellen Sie einen eindimensionalen Tensor, einen Skalar und erhöhen Sie jedes Element in einem Tensor auf einen Skalarwert.






Tensorflow.JS - TF.pow ()




Ausgang

Abschluss

tf.pow () im Tensorflow.JS wird verwendet, um die Leistung in Bezug auf die Werte in einem anderen Tensor zu erhöhen. Wir haben auch festgestellt, dass Scalar nur einen Wert speichert und einen Tensor zurückgibt. Während der Durchführung von TF.Pow () Bei zwei Tensoren stellen Sie sicher, dass die Anzahl der Elemente in zwei Tensoren gleich sein muss.